Martin pistorius is a freelance web designer, developer, and author born in 1975, best known for his 2011 book ghost boy, in which he describes living with lockedin syndrome and being unable to move for 12 to 14 years. Martin pistorius was a healthy 12yearold boy growing up in south africa when his life took an unexpected turn. In these pages readers see a parents resilience, the consequences of misdiagnosis, abuse at the hands of cruel caretakers, and the unthinkable duration of martin s mental alertness betrayed by his lifeless body.

He began regaining consciousness around age 16 and achieved full consciousness by age 19, although he was still completely paralyzed with the exception of his eyes. Ghost boy charts the story of south african martin pistorius, who slipped into a mysterious comalike state at age 12 and was written off as a lost causeuntil a devoted nurse recognized the active imagination behind the unresponsive body.
